Finally found another SS in good shape. The cart was as solid as they come, zero rust. The gentleman that had it bought it new and kept in on the lower level under his deck so it didn't get any rain, just several years of crud from being outside. The lid and bowl didn't have any dents, just a few scratches. He had the original manual and the filler for the tank and the tube cleaning wire. He had just bought a new Weber gasser and I guess wanted someone to enjoy a nice performer for cheap ($35.00)
I cleaned the bowl and lid with EZ-Off and disassembled the cart, sanded it down, replaced all of the hardware with SS and repainted. Painted the ash bowl black. Just finished putting it back together late last night. The first pic is of the CL ad, the second is from last night when I finished. (Should get several years use out of this one)

Nice find! I have a 1998 Red Brick/Maroon(whatever you wanna call it). Weber CS told me it is actually called Williams Sonoma Brown. It looks like you got the Stok CI Grates. Its in great shape. I just picked up a 2010 Performer that was purchased earlier this year. I'm happy with it but if I find a SS Blue in good condition I think I will have to trade.
 
That's interesting, in the parts listing for the old performer under replacement bowl it shows burgundy.

"90074 Bowl for 22-1/2-inch Performer Touch-N-Go grill. 2000 model year. Burgundy."
